Understanding Dual-Purpose Needs: Camping vs. Indoor Emergency
To find the ideal dual-purpose light, you must first understand how outdoor lighting requirements differ from indoor emergency needs. When you are camping, your light source is exposed to the elements. It needs to withstand wind, rain, and accidental drops on rough terrain. Outdoor lights also require a wide, powerful beam spread to illuminate open campsites, dark trails, or pitch-black tent surroundings. High water-resistance ratings and rugged, shock-absorbing casings are non-negotiable for these environments.

Indoors, the priorities shift toward comfort, safety, and controlled illumination. A high-power outdoor beam that easily lights up a forest clearing will be blindingly harsh when reflected off the white walls of a compact HDB living room. Indoor emergency lighting requires excellent diffusion to prevent glare, along with adjustable color temperatures. A warm, soft light is far more comforting and less disruptive to family members—especially young children or the elderly—during a stressful blackout than a cold, clinical blue-white beam.
Balancing these needs requires looking at the trade-offs between rugged durability and indoor aesthetics. Heavy-duty tactical lanterns with thick rubber armor and bright orange accents might look out of place sitting on a Scandinavian-style sideboard, but they offer unmatched resilience. Conversely, sleek, minimalist lanterns designed primarily for home decor may lack the necessary ingress protection (IP) ratings to survive a sudden tropical downpour during an outdoor trek. The key is to find a middle ground: a clean, compact design that features robust weatherproofing without looking overly industrial.
Key Features to Evaluate for Dual-Use Camping Lights
When evaluating potential lights, brightness control and beam versatility should be your first considerations. Look for lights that measure their output in lumens and offer multiple brightness settings or stepless dimming. For general indoor use in a standard HDB room, an output of 100 to 300 lumens is typically sufficient to read, cook, or navigate safely. Outdoors, you may want the option to boost the output to 500 lumens or more. A light that allows you to switch between a cool white light (useful for task work or searching for items) and a warm yellow light (ideal for relaxing in a tent or dining at home) provides the ultimate versatility.

Power sources and charging methods dictate how reliable your light will be during an extended outage. USB-C charging has become the modern standard, allowing you to quickly recharge the light using your existing phone chargers, wall outlets, or portable power banks. However, for true emergency readiness, consider “dual-fuel” models. These devices feature a built-in rechargeable lithium-ion battery but also accept standard alkaline batteries (such as AA or AAA). This design ensures that if your rechargeable battery runs flat during a prolonged blackout, you can simply pop in a fresh set of store-bought batteries to keep the light running.
Mounting and placement flexibility are equally critical for both campsites and high-rise apartments. A versatile light should feature a flat, weighted base so it can stand securely on a kitchen counter, dining table, or bedside cabinet without tipping over. Integrated folding hooks or carabiner clips are essential for hanging the light from tent loops, curtain rods, or even clothes drying racks. Additionally, a magnetic base is an incredibly useful feature for HDB flats, allowing you to snap the light directly onto metal surfaces like the refrigerator, metal shelving units, or the steel door frame of your household shelter.
Adapting to HDB Living: Storage, Space, and Readiness
Space is at a premium in most Singapore apartments, meaning your emergency gear should not take up half a closet. Collapsible or folding camping lights are highly advantageous for HDB living. Many modern lanterns can compress down to the size of a small disc or a slim wand, allowing them to slide easily into standard utility drawers, shoe cabinets, or compact emergency grab-and-go bags. Choosing a space-efficient design ensures your light is always stored in an accessible location rather than buried deep in a storage room.
Maintaining battery health during long periods of inactivity is a common challenge for emergency equipment. Lithium-ion batteries naturally self-discharge over time, and storing them completely empty or permanently at 100% charge can accelerate degradation. To maximize battery lifespan, store your rechargeable lights at approximately 50% to 70% capacity in a cool, dry place. Singapore’s high tropical humidity can also affect electronic components and battery contacts, so keeping your light in a sealed container with a few silica gel packets is an excellent preventive measure.
Establishing a simple readiness routine ensures you are never left in the dark when a power failure occurs. Mark your calendar to perform a quick check of your emergency lights once every three to six months. During this check, turn the lights on to verify they are functioning, inspect the casings for any signs of damage, and top up the charge to the recommended storage level. If your light uses replaceable alkaline batteries, store the batteries outside the device in a separate organizer to prevent corrosive chemical leaks from ruining the light’s internal circuitry.
Building Your Shortlist: Matching Features to Your Profile
To narrow down your choices, match the specifications of the light to your household’s lifestyle and camping habits.
Profile A: The Active Adventurer
If you camp frequently, hike in wet conditions, or spend entire weekends outdoors, prioritize ruggedness and high performance. Look for a light with an IPX6 water-resistance rating or higher, a drop-resistant housing certified to withstand falls of at least one meter, and a high-capacity battery (5,000 mAh or more). This profile benefits from a light that can handle a heavy downpour at a campsite but still offers a low-lumen, warm-light mode suitable for indoor emergency use.
Profile B: The Prepared Homeowner
If your outdoor trips are limited to occasional family picnics or light glamping, prioritize compact storage, ease of use, and aesthetic integration. Look for a lightweight, collapsible lantern with a clean design that blends in with your home decor. A battery capacity of 2,000 to 3,000 mAh is usually sufficient for this profile, provided the light features a reliable USB-C charging port and can be easily tucked away in a living room drawer.
Final Verification Checklist
Before finalizing your purchase from an online marketplace or local retailer, run through a quick verification checklist. Ensure the product specifications clearly state the battery type, runtime on various brightness levels, and charging requirements. If the light comes with an integrated wall plug or charger, verify that it carries the appropriate local safety certifications. Finally, check the manufacturer’s warranty terms and return policies so you can easily exchange the unit if you detect any battery or charging anomalies right out of the box.
Safety, Maintenance, and Battery Care
Operating high-output LED lights in enclosed spaces requires basic safety precautions. While LEDs are far safer than traditional gas or candle lanterns because they do not produce open flames or carbon monoxide, they can still generate significant heat at the light source and battery compartment. When running a high-lumen light inside a small HDB room, ensure the device is placed in a well-ventilated area. Avoid covering the light with fabrics, paper, or placing it in tight, unventilated corners where heat can build up.
Proper battery care is essential to prevent hazardous failures, such as swelling, leakage, or thermal runaway. Never leave your rechargeable camping lights plugged into a charger indefinitely; disconnect them once they reach full charge to avoid overstressing the battery cells. If you are using lights that rely on alkaline batteries, always use high-quality, brand-name batteries and replace them as a complete set. Mixing old and new batteries, or mixing different battery brands, can cause rapid discharge and increase the risk of acid leakage.
Knowing when to retire and replace your light is crucial for maintaining a safe household. Inspect your devices regularly for physical warning signs. If you notice a swollen or bulging casing, a battery that becomes unusually hot during charging, a significant drop in runtime, or persistent flickering that cannot be resolved, stop using the light immediately. Dispose of the degraded device safely by taking it to a designated e-waste recycling point, which can be found at various community centers and electronics retailers across Singapore.
Frequently Asked Questions (FAQ)
Can I use a camping lantern with a built-in power bank to charge my phone during an HDB blackout?
Yes, many modern camping lanterns feature a USB-A or USB-C output port designed to charge external devices. However, using this feature comes with a major trade-off: charging a smartphone will rapidly deplete the lantern’s battery, potentially leaving you without light before the power is restored. Always check the milliampere-hour (mAh) capacity of your lantern. If the capacity is relatively low, it is best to reserve the lantern strictly for illumination and rely on dedicated portable power banks to keep your mobile phones charged.
Are solar-powered camping lights reliable for indoor emergency use in an HDB flat?
Solar-powered lights are highly useful for outdoor trips, but they are generally unreliable as a primary charging method inside an HDB flat. Standard residential window glass, especially the tinted or double-glazed glass found in modern flats, filters out a significant portion of the solar spectrum, which drastically slows down charging times. Furthermore, high-rise apartments may not receive direct, unobstructed sunlight for long enough periods to achieve a full charge. For reliable indoor emergency readiness, always choose a light that supports USB charging as its primary power source, treating solar panels only as a secondary, last-resort backup.
